Public Hearing RE: Ordinance 2007-01: At this time Council conducted a public hearing to receive written and/or oral comments regarding proposed Ordinance 2007-01, AN ORDINANCE TO PROVIDE FOR THE ISSUANCE AND SALE OF A NOT EXCEEDING ONE MILLION TWO HUNDRED THOUSAND DOLLAR ($1,200,000) OCONEE COUNTY, SOUTH CAROLINA, GENERAL OBLIGATION BOND (KEOWEE TAX DISTRICT PROJECT), SERIES 2007; TO PRESCRIBE THE PURPOSES FOR WHICH THE PROCEEDS SHALL BE EXPENDED; TO PROVIDE FOR THE PAYMENT THEREOF; AND OTHER MATTERS RELATING THERETO. In response to an inquiry from a citizen, Mr. Norton, County Attorney, explained that this ordinance did not affect anyone except the citizens living in the Keowee Fire District. There was no other written and/or oral comments regarding this ordinance. Road Department (Contingency): Mr. Blanchard made a motion, seconded by Mr. Crumpton, approved 5 0 that the bid process be waived and a used bucket truck for the Road Department be purchased from Trueco, Inc. at a cost of $63,500 and necessary implements for the bucket truck be purchased from Ditch Witch of the Carolinas at a cost of $3,500 with funding coming from the following sources: Roads & Bridges - $56,000; Economic Development - $1,000 and Contingency - $10,000. (See attached) Solid Waste: Mr. Crumpton made a motion, seconded by Mr. Ables, approved 5 0 that the bid process be waived and three cardboard compactors and three containers be purchased from Bakers Waste Equipment of Greenville SC at a cost of $51,600. (See attached) Emergency Management: Emergency Management be authorized to apply for a Community Emergency Response Team grant in the amount of $7,000. If received, this grant requires no local match.
Oconee County Board of Disabilities (Contingency): the County donate sixty (60) tons of crusher run gravel to the Oconee County Board of Disabilities (Tribble Center) with the cost of $410 coming from contingency. (See attached request) Treasurer s Office (Contingency): Mr. Crumpton made a motion, seconded by Mr. Blanchard, approved 5 0 that temporary help in the Treasurer s Office be extended through March 2007 with the $1,700 cost coming from contingency. Opposition to Takings Bill: Mr. Blanchard made a motion, seconded by Mr. Ables, approved 5 0 that Council send the Legislative Delegation a letter in opposition to the Takings or Bad Neighbor bill. Planning Department: Mr. Blanchard made a motion, seconded by Mr. Ables, approved 5 0 that the Planning Department be directed to develop the process and procedures for variances. This process is to include public notification of such a hearing and then afford public comment before any action is taken.
